1. Adjust the temperatureAlthough we have just entered autumn, the temperature is still relatively suitable for the growth of Chinese lucky charm. However, once it enters late autumn, the temperature in some areas may become very low, affecting its normal growth. At this time, certain measures need to be taken to keep it warm and maintain the temperature between 8-20℃. It cannot be lower than 8℃, otherwise it may freeze, but it cannot be higher than 20℃, otherwise it may disturb its hibernation. 2. Proper lightingAt the beginning of autumn, the light intensity is still relatively high. Therefore, it needs to be placed in a place where it cannot be exposed to direct sunlight for maintenance. However, as autumn approaches, the intensity of light decreases. At this time, you need to increase the time it is exposed to light to prevent it from fading. 3. Reduce wateringAfter entering autumn, the growth rate of the plant will slow down. Therefore, the frequency of watering it should be reduced, generally watering it once every 7-10 days is sufficient. Before watering, you can touch the surface of the soil with your hand. After it feels dry, water it. If it is not dry yet, don't water it yet. In addition, when autumn begins and the temperature is relatively high, you can spray some water mist around it to maintain the humidity of the air, which is more conducive to its growth. |
